What is the Best Temperature to Freeze Meat for Optimal Preservation?
The best temperature to freeze meat for optimal preservation is 0°F (-18°C) or lower. At this temperature, the growth of bacteria, yeasts, and molds is effectively halted, ensuring that meat retains its quality, texture, and nutritional value during storage.
According to the U.S. Department of Agriculture (USDA), freezing meat at 0°F or lower preserves its safety and quality indefinitely. However, for the best taste and texture, it’s recommended to consume frozen meat within specific time frames, depending on the type of meat. For instance, beef can be stored for 4 to 12 months, while poultry is best consumed within 1 year of freezing.
Key aspects of freezing meat include the type of packaging used, the speed of freezing, and the initial temperature of the meat. Proper packaging, such as vacuum sealing or using airtight containers, minimizes freezer burn and helps maintain moisture. Rapid freezing is also essential, as it forms smaller ice crystals, which reduces cellular damage and preserves the meat’s texture. Additionally, starting with meat that is as cold as possible before freezing can enhance quality.
This practice impacts food safety and reduces waste. When meat is frozen properly at the optimal temperature, it can be stored for extended periods without significant quality degradation. According to the Food and Drug Administration (FDA), freezing food does not kill bacteria, but it does prevent them from growing, making it an essential method for preserving meat for future use.
The benefits of freezing meat at the correct temperature include cost savings, as buying in bulk and freezing can reduce grocery bills. It also allows for meal prepping and provides convenience, ensuring that high-quality protein is readily available. Additionally, freezing can help manage supply chain disruptions, allowing households to stock up during sales or shortages.
Best practices for freezing meat include ensuring that the freezer is set to 0°F or lower, using appropriate packaging to prevent freezer burn, and labeling packages with dates for better inventory management. It is also advisable to portion meat into smaller sizes before freezing, as this facilitates quicker thawing and reduces waste.
Why is Freezing Temperature Critical for Maintaining Meat Quality?
Freezing temperature is critical for maintaining meat quality because it inhibits microbial growth and enzyme activity, which can lead to spoilage and degradation of the meat’s texture and flavor.
According to the USDA, meat should be frozen at 0°F (-18°C) or lower to ensure safety and quality. At this temperature, the growth of bacteria and other pathogens is effectively halted, preventing foodborne illnesses. Additionally, enzymes that can cause spoilage and loss of flavor are also deactivated, which helps preserve the meat’s original characteristics for a longer duration.
The underlying mechanism involves the formation of ice crystals within the meat. When meat is frozen too slowly, larger ice crystals can develop, which may damage the cellular structure of the meat. This leads to moisture loss upon thawing, resulting in a dry and less palatable product. Rapid freezing at the optimal temperature minimizes ice crystal formation, thereby preserving the meat’s texture and juiciness. Furthermore, proper freezing techniques, such as using vacuum-sealed bags, can further enhance the quality by reducing exposure to air and preventing freezer burn, which can also affect taste and appearance.
What Are the Different Freezing Temperatures for Various Types of Meat?
The best temperatures for freezing different types of meat vary to ensure quality and safety.
- Beef: The ideal freezing temperature for beef is 0°F (-18°C) or lower. At this temperature, beef maintains its quality for several months, preventing freezer burn and preserving flavor.
- Pork: Pork should also be frozen at 0°F (-18°C) or lower. This ensures that the meat retains its moisture and texture, allowing it to be stored for up to six months without significant loss of quality.
- Poultry: Chicken and turkey can be frozen at 0°F (-18°C) as well. When properly wrapped, these meats can remain fresh for up to a year, making them a flexible option for meal preparation.
- Lamb: Lamb is best frozen at 0°F (-18°C) or lower, similar to other meats. Properly packaged, it can last around six months in the freezer, maintaining its unique flavor and tenderness.
- Fish: Fish should ideally be frozen at 0°F (-18°C), but fatty fish like salmon should be consumed within two to three months for the best quality. Lean fish can be stored for longer, up to six months, if wrapped correctly to prevent freezer burn.
- Ground Meat: Ground meats, including beef, pork, and poultry, should be frozen at 0°F (-18°C). They are best consumed within three to four months due to their higher surface area, which makes them more susceptible to freezer burn.
How Should I Freeze Red Meat to Ensure Its Freshness?
To effectively freeze red meat while maintaining its freshness, consider the following factors:
- Optimal Freezing Temperature: The best temperature to freeze meat is 0°F (-18°C) or lower.
- Proper Packaging: Use airtight packaging to prevent freezer burn and preserve quality.
- Portion Control: Divide meat into smaller portions before freezing for quicker freezing and thawing.
- Labeling: Always label packages with the date and type of meat to track freshness.
- Thawing Method: Plan for safe thawing methods to maintain quality when you’re ready to use the meat.
Optimal Freezing Temperature: Freezing red meat at 0°F (-18°C) or lower is crucial as it halts the growth of bacteria and preserves the meat’s texture and flavor. Maintaining this temperature ensures that the meat remains safe for consumption over an extended period.
Proper Packaging: To prevent freezer burn, which can affect the taste and texture, wrap red meat tightly in plastic wrap, aluminum foil, or vacuum-sealed bags. Airtight packaging reduces exposure to air, which is the main cause of freezer burn.
Portion Control: By dividing meat into smaller portions before freezing, you can ensure that each piece freezes more quickly and thaws evenly. This practice not only saves time during meal preparation but also helps to maintain the meat’s quality.
Labeling: It is essential to label each package with the date and type of meat to maintain an organized freezer and track how long the meat has been stored. This practice helps ensure that you use older products first, minimizing waste.
Thawing Method: When it comes time to use the frozen meat, it’s important to thaw it safely in the refrigerator, cold water, or the microwave rather than at room temperature. This prevents the growth of harmful bacteria and helps maintain the meat’s texture and flavor during the cooking process.
What is the Best Technique for Freezing Poultry Safely?
The best technique for freezing poultry safely involves maintaining the appropriate temperature and following best practices to ensure food safety and quality. The ideal temperature to freeze meat, including poultry, is 0°F (-18°C) or lower. At this temperature, bacterial growth is effectively halted, preserving the meat’s quality for an extended period.
According to the USDA, freezing poultry at 0°F or below keeps it safe indefinitely, although for optimal quality, it is recommended to consume it within a year. Additionally, the National Chicken Council emphasizes that proper packaging is crucial to prevent freezer burn, which can negatively affect texture and flavor.
Key aspects of freezing poultry safely include using airtight packaging, such as vacuum-sealed bags or heavy-duty aluminum foil, to minimize exposure to air. It’s also essential to label packages with the date of freezing to keep track of their storage duration. Moreover, it is advisable to freeze poultry as soon as possible after purchase to maintain freshness. Thawing frozen poultry should be done in the refrigerator, cold water, or microwave, rather than at room temperature, to prevent the growth of harmful bacteria.
This practice impacts food safety significantly, as improperly frozen or thawed poultry can lead to foodborne illnesses. According to the Centers for Disease Control and Prevention (CDC), poultry is a common source of Salmonella and Campylobacter, which can cause serious health issues when consumed. Proper freezing techniques not only help in preventing these pathogens from proliferating but also extend the shelf life of the meat.
The benefits of freezing poultry correctly include cost savings—buying in bulk and freezing allows consumers to take advantage of sales—and convenience, as having frozen poultry on hand means meal preparation can be quicker. Additionally, freezing preserves the nutritional quality of poultry, ensuring that essential vitamins and minerals remain intact for later consumption.
Best practices for freezing poultry include portioning it into meal-sized packages before freezing, which makes it easier to thaw only what is needed. Ensuring that the freezer temperature is consistently at 0°F or lower is vital, and using a freezer thermometer can help monitor this. Furthermore, maintaining good freezer organization can help prevent the accidental freezing of poultry past its optimal quality timeframe. Regularly checking and rotating stock is advisable to maintain freshness.
How Can I Best Freeze Seafood Without Compromising Quality?
The best practices for freezing seafood to maintain its quality involve temperature control, proper packaging, and rapid freezing techniques.
- Optimal Freezing Temperature: The best temp to freeze seafood is at or below 0°F (-18°C).
- Proper Packaging: Use air-tight packaging materials to prevent freezer burn.
- Rapid Freezing: Freeze seafood quickly to maintain texture and flavor.
- Pre-Freezing Preparation: Clean and prepare seafood properly before freezing.
- Labeling and Dating: Always label packages with the date and type of seafood for better tracking.
Optimal Freezing Temperature: The best temp to freeze seafood is at or below 0°F (-18°C) to ensure that bacteria and enzymes that can degrade quality are halted. Maintaining this temperature is crucial for preserving the flavor, texture, and nutritional value of the seafood over time.
Proper Packaging: Use vacuum-sealed bags or heavy-duty freezer wraps to create an airtight seal around the seafood. This prevents exposure to air, which can lead to freezer burn and compromise the seafood’s quality and taste.
Rapid Freezing: Freezing seafood quickly, such as using a blast freezer or spreading out pieces on a baking sheet before transferring them to the freezer, helps maintain its cellular structure. This practice prevents the formation of large ice crystals that can damage the texture of the seafood.
Pre-Freezing Preparation: Clean and properly prepare seafood by removing shells, cleaning, and cutting it into portions if necessary. This not only aids in even freezing but also makes it easier to use later without additional preparation.
Labeling and Dating: Always label each package with the type of seafood and the date it was frozen. This practice helps in managing your inventory and ensures that you use older items first, reducing waste and maintaining quality.
What Happens to Meat Quality if Frozen at Incorrect Temperatures?
If meat is frozen at incorrect temperatures, it can lead to loss of quality, texture, and flavor.
- Freezing at Above 0°F (-18°C): When meat is frozen at temperatures above 0°F, it may not freeze quickly enough, leading to the formation of larger ice crystals. These larger crystals can damage the muscle fibers, resulting in a mushy texture once the meat is thawed.
- Inconsistent Freezing Temperatures: Fluctuating temperatures during the freezing process can cause partial thawing and refreezing of meat. This not only affects the quality by creating a dry texture but also increases the risk of freezer burn, which occurs when the surface of the meat becomes dehydrated.
- Long-Term Storage at Improper Temperatures: Storing meat for extended periods at temperatures that are not cold enough can lead to spoilage and a decline in flavor. Even if the meat appears visually acceptable, harmful bacteria can proliferate, posing food safety risks.
- Freezer Burn: Freezer burn occurs when meat is not properly wrapped or stored, exposing it to air. This leads to dehydration and oxidation, resulting in dry patches and off-flavors, which can significantly diminish the overall quality of the meat.
- Impact on Nutritional Value: Incorrect freezing temperatures can also affect the nutritional value of the meat. While freezing generally preserves nutrients, if meat is stored improperly, there may be a gradual loss of vitamins and minerals over time.
How Long Can Different Types of Meat Last in the Freezer at Ideal Temperatures?
The ideal freezing duration for different types of meat varies based on the type of meat and the conditions of freezing.
- Beef: Beef can last up to 12 months in the freezer when stored at 0°F (-18°C) or lower.
- Pork: Pork is best consumed within 4 to 6 months when frozen at the ideal temperature of 0°F (-18°C) to maintain its quality.
- Poultry: Whole chickens and turkeys can be frozen for up to a year, while chicken parts should be consumed within 9 months for optimal flavor and texture.
- Lamb: Lamb can last about 6 to 9 months in the freezer at the recommended freezing temperature of 0°F (-18°C).
- Fish: Fatty fish can last about 2 to 3 months while lean fish can be stored for up to 6 months, both at the ideal freezing temperature.
- Ground meats: Ground beef, pork, chicken, or turkey should ideally be consumed within 3 to 4 months of freezing for the best quality.
Beef is a robust meat that retains its flavor and texture well, allowing for a longer freezing period of up to 12 months, which is essential for meal prep and bulk buying.
Pork has a shorter freezing lifespan of 4 to 6 months, as its fat content can lead to freezer burn if not properly wrapped and stored.
Poultry, whether whole or in parts, has a long shelf life in the freezer, with whole birds lasting up to a year, making it a staple for many households.
Lamb, with its rich flavor, should ideally be consumed within 6 to 9 months to ensure it remains tender and flavorful when cooked.
Fish varies significantly; fatty fish like salmon should be consumed within 2 to 3 months to avoid a decline in quality, while lean varieties can last longer but still require proper storage techniques.
Ground meats have a shorter freezer life of 3 to 4 months, largely due to their increased surface area, which can lead to faster freezer burn if not sealed properly.
